Maybe make your MC4 crimps when not connected to the panels or with the panels separated into smaller groups? You could leave the center of the string (s) unplugged to break the circuit and remove any chance of getting a shock.

Electric shock hazards from high DC voltages require comprehensive arc-flash protection, properly rated personal protective equipment (PPE), and strict lockout-tagout procedures during installation and maintenance. . Safety protocols in photovoltaic system installation demand rigorous attention to protect both installers and end-users. To ensure electrical safety during solar energy installations, follow these key measures: Proper Training: Workers should undergo comprehensive training on electrical safety protocols.
